“…Piwnica-worms et al identified a new molecule 4-[ 18 F]fluoro-1-naphthol ([ 18 F]4FN) that could selectively react with high-energy free radicals and be used for whole-body imaging by PET/CT to detect multiorgan inflammation in real time. 119 When oxidized by myeloperoxidase plus H 2 O 2 , [ 18 F]4FN selectively binds to nearby proteins and cells. Studies have shown that [ 18 F]4FN is superior to [ 18 F]FDG in detecting inflammation.…”
